Who Should Attend

The Association for Communication Excellence (ACE) hosts an annual conference ideal for communication professionals, educators, and researchers in the fields of agriculture, natural resources, and life sciences. Attendees will gain valuable insights into the latest trends, foster innovative collaborations, and enhance their impact across various sectors. This conference is designed for those who are eager to level up their skills, engage with like-minded experts, and grow within their professions. Cruising Milwaukee

Did you know that Milwaukee sits at the confluence of the Milwaukee River and Lake Michigan? Join us at the 2025 ACE Conference for a two-hour boat cruise. The private charter will disembark from Pere Marquette, just steps from the Hyatt Regency, and feature spectacular views of Milwaukee’s famous lakefront. 

The tour is scheduled for Tuesday, June 17, with the boat departing at 6:00 p.m. sharp and returning at 8:00 p.m. The cost is $25.00.

Food & Drinks: Not provided, but may be brought onboard (guests must take all trash with them).
